Why is singing psalms important for Christians?

Answered in 1 source

Singing psalms is important for Christians as it expresses gratitude and joy towards God, as highlighted in James 5:13.

James 5:13 tells us, 'Is any merry? Let him sing psalms.' Singing psalms is a biblical mandate that reflects the believer's joy and gratitude for God's goodness and deliverance. Worship through song is a means of encouraging one another and celebrating God's faithfulness in our lives. It also nurtures our spiritual growth and strengthens our communal bonds as believers. The act of singing serves as both a response to God's blessings and a source of encouragement during trials, reminding us of His sovereignty and grace. As believers engage in this practice, they affirm their faith and draw closer to God, experiencing a deeper understanding of His character and promises.
Scripture References: James 5:13, Colossians 3:16, Ephesians 5:18-19
